Restaurant Summary

Tucked just off Gran Vía inside a sleek hotel, this room feels calm and polished—a cool retreat from Madrid’s bustle. Servers greet with warmth and helpful guidance; one guest noted they felt looked after from first hello. However, expect a mixed crowd of travelers and locals in a stylish hotel setting rather than a neighborhood bodega vibe. The cooking leans modern Spanish—clean flavors, good produce, and thoughtful technique—more elevated comfort than experimental fireworks. Plates like corvina ceviche, black rice with scallops, and cod at low temperature show care, while desserts like Chocolate Ecstasy hit a sweet spot. There are robust vegan options alongside meats and seafood, so mixed groups eat well. Prices reflect the location and ingredients, not tapas-bar bargains. Families are welcomed with friendly service and familiar dishes kids will recognize—paella, burgers, pasta—though portions and presentation skew upscale. No explicit kids menu surfaced, but choices are flexible; expect hotel-level calm over chaos, which suits parents seeking comfort after a day out.

SolSol is one of Madrid's most famous neighborhoods, centered around the Puerta del Sol square. It features a lively dining scene with a mix of traditional tapas bars, modern eateries, and international cuisine, attracting a diverse crowd throughout the day and night. The area is busy, accessible, and a key social and cultural meeting point.
Gran VíaGran Vía is a renowned street known for its theaters, shopping, and vibrant nightlife. It hosts a variety of restaurants ranging from casual to upscale, catering to a cosmopolitan crowd seeking entertainment and dining in a dynamic urban setting.
